Hi fellow pilots,

i have a question. I see KA Chopper, i see Gazelle .. but why is there no AH 64 ? A Fiat G91 ? No Tornado...

Is this simulation in any way restricted ? Special model policy ? I am realy busy at the moment with the test of the su 25 :-)... i like the combination of action features and high detailed simulation...

Just was wondering, why so many realy world famous models are not in flight :-)

It's all dependant on the amount of information available. A lot of aircraft that are in use to this day have a lot of classified information and so that specific info won't be available to complete and round out the simulation model. Hence why the Tonka and typhoon etc aren't being made because of classified info. Maybe later down the line.

What BlazingTrigger said.

 

Plus, it's a matter of limited resources. I'm sure many devs would love to do those modules. As I recall it, ED themselves had originally planned to do the AH-64 (probably an A-model) after the A-10C, but plans tend to change as reality strikes. ;)
